Personal Introduction
Erik P. Weingold is an entrepreneur and corporate securities lawyer with nearly 30 years’ experience under his belt. His journey in the legal field began in 1995, when he started practicing law and quickly proved himself as a rising talent. In the early years of his career, Mr. Weingold demonstrated his legal acumen and entrepreneurial spirit while serving as the General Counsel to a startup encryption software company, Wormhole Technologies, Inc. It was here that he drafted his first Private Placement Memorandum (PPM), a pivotal endeavor that successfully secured seed capital financing of over $500,000 for the budding company. Building on this achievement, he expanded his expertise in drafting PPMs, using them as key instruments to raise many hundreds of millions of dollars for startups, real estate syndications/funds, and investment funds throughout the U.S. starting from 1998. Simultaneously, he climbed the professional ladder within the legal sector, moving from an associate at a law firm to serving as a corporate counsel for a renowned global Fortune 500 company. This role saw him navigate the complexities of corporate law on an international scale, further honing his capabilities. In an ambitious move, Mr. Weingold eventually founded Weingold Law-PPM LAWYERS, bringing his diverse experience and deep understanding of corporate securities law to his own practice. Since its establishment in 2015, he has utilized his extensive knowledge of SEC regulations and his entrepreneurial insight to guide hundreds of clients through successful funding rounds, cumulatively raising many hundreds of millions of dollars and solidifying his reputation as a leading figure in the field.

Practice Summary
PPM LAWYERS represents early and development stage and startup companies throughout the U.S. Our mission is to provide our clients with the highest quality and most professional private placement memorandum (PPM) and legal support available, while helping them navigate the complex securities laws governing their private placement and equity crowdfunding efforts. Our clients understand that they must avoid Big Law fees for this type of service (which can be $25,000 or more), but they also don’t want to settle for a bargain brand or less qualified legal professional. PPM LAWYERS fills this void by operating one of the only legal services firms in the U.S. that focuses exclusively on private placements.
